摘 要:目的比较传统手术(A组)与3D打印辅助手术(B组)治疗复杂髋臼骨折的近期临床效果。方法分析我院行手术治疗的35例复杂髋臼骨折患者资料,其中13例患者行3D打印辅助设计手术,依此对髋臼骨折做出明确的诊断、分型,术前模拟复位固定手术。余22例患者行常规手术,比较两组手术创伤程度及全身炎性反应,Matta影像学评定术后骨折块即刻复位效果,Merled′Aubigne和Postel评分,髋关节活动功能评分评价术后康复功能状态。结果两组手术时间、术中出血量、术后引流量比较有统计学意义(P<0.05),B组优于A组。A组术后24 h外周血C反应蛋白、白细胞计数以及肌酸激酶较术前明显升高,两组间比较差异显著(P<0.01),术后即刻复位效果B组优于A组,优良复位率达84.6%,两组比较差异有统计学意义(P=0.034),末次随访改良的Merled′Aubigne和Postel评分A组优良率为50%,B组为92.3%,两组比较有统计学意义(P=0.013)。B组髋关节Harris功能评分优良率明显高于A组(P=0.027)。结论 3D打印技术辅助复杂髋臼骨折手术治疗创伤小,术后复位效果好,近期疗效满意,长期效果有待于进一步随访结果。Objective To evaluate the advantage of 3D printing technique in treatment of complicated acetabula fracture, we compared the early clinical outcomes of surgical treatment for complex aeetabula fracture with traditional surgery (group A) and that assisted by 3D printing technique (group B). Methods A prospective anal- ysis of 35 complicated acetabula fractures was performed at our department, 13 patients cured assisted with 3D printing technique. The other 22 patients performed traditional surgery. Surgical trauma, systematic inflammation, immediate reduction effect were evaluated by Matta image assessment standard, and rehabilitation functional status evaluated by Harris score system and Merled' Aubigne and Postel Grading standard. Results There were signifi- cant differences between the two groups regarding intraoperative blood loss, postoperative drainage, operation time (P 〈 0.05 ), and group B was superior to group A. C reactive protein, leucocyte and creatine kinase MM in periph- eral blood in group A were much higher than those in group B at 24 hours postoperatively (P 〈 0.01 ). The result of reduction of fracture is poor in group A, but excellent rate of reduction is about 84% in group B. The result of Merled' Aubigne and Postel scores grading was superior in group B (P = 0.013). The excellent and good rate of Harris function score in B group was significantly higher than that in group A (P = 0.027 ). Conclusion The treat- ment of complicated acetabula fracture assisted by 3D printing is excellent in short-term follow up, achieving good reduction with limited trauma, long-term prognosis needs to be further followed up.
